Output e96ec4225778879c6b889847bade167aedb095ea6dc598c5d3c76f28e229244e:1

value
38828
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32c36169e05d0234a7279f51a712cf50ee40b143 OP_EQUALVERIFY OP_CHECKSIG
address
15dQqsMWbWNu1KRLt7KrtdLo814FsRLnu7
transaction
e96ec4225778879c6b889847bade167aedb095ea6dc598c5d3c76f28e229244e
spent
true